Was that image originally a .psd or .pdd (photoshop image)? Or is that copied from another?

The only thing I am thinking you can do is to copy the image into a "new" file, and save it that way. Sometimes an "altered" version of certain files (psd, pdd and bmp's) types will not "re-save" from the original as different file types (jpg, gif) i.e. a bmp I was working with yesterday... I altered it in its original form, but could not "save as" into jpg form... I had to copy the entire image and paste into a "new file", then "save as" works :) I know that most of the time I have to copy the .bmp graphic into a new file in order to save it into gif or jpg form (I hate bmp's LOL).
